Вы не зашли.
Главная » PHP » Помогите с IP...
#1. @Office Off (0)
Участник
2010.08.09 20:08
Вобщем возникла проблема, немогу никак вытащить нужные данные.

Вобщем:
Есть таблица: partners_base_ip
В ней ячейки: id oper min max
min - IP нчало
max - IP конец

Есть IP в виде целого числа например: 2073474921

Так вот, мне нужно вытащить из базы ячейку oper к которой принадлежит этот ип.

Делаю как-то так:
select `partners_base_oper`.`id` from `partners_base_oper` INNER JOIN `partners_base_ip` ON `partners_base_ip`.`oper` = `partners_base_oper`.`id` where ".$ip." BETWEEN `partners_base_ip`.`min` AND `partners_base_ip`.`max` limit 1

невыходит sad
IPа в базе именно такого нет, есть только больше, и меньше, вот мне и надо найти промежуточный, и вывести данные из поля oper, думаю понятн объяснил? или нет?  sad
Вобщем незнаю как подругому объяснить...
tongue
#2. @Office Off (0)
Участник
2010.08.09 21:09
#close, разобрался.
tongue
Страниц: 1
Главная
WEB
PunBB Mod v0.6.2
0.013 s